Joann,. You'll need a Hilti gun, it penetrates cement. If you don't have one, you can rent one at Home Depot. It goes by the hour. You also need a deposit, and an ID. You can rent from say 3 pm-3 pm the next day that's 24 hrs. Aloha!
I'd use screws and anchors, personally. Drill your hole (with the correct drill bit), insert anchor, tighten screw.
Look for tap-con screws. They come with a special drill bit and anchor solidly.
